What public transport options are available in the Wauchope area?
Wauchope has its own railway station on the North Coast Line, providing regular NSW TrainLink services to Sydney, Grafton, Casino, and Brisbane.
What are some of the local attractions and activities near 59 Colonial Circuit?
In addition to Timbertown, the area offers the Hastings Farmers Markets at the showground, nearby state forests, Bago Bluff National Park, and the Wauchope Golf Course and Country Club just south of the main shopping precinct.
